#19781e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#19781e is composed of 9.8% red, 47.1%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 75%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 123.2 degrees, a saturation of 65.5% and a lightness of 28.4%. #19781e color hex could be obtained by blending #32f03c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

Shades and Tints of #19781e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010602 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#19781e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#464b46 is the less saturated color, while #038e0a is the most saturated one.
